Subject: Quickstore 4.2 — bloom filter now fronts the KV layer

Plugin authors: starting with this release, Quickstore places a bloom filter ahead of the key-value store. Negative lookups return faster; false positives fall through safely. No API changes are required on your side. Verify your plugin against the staging build referenced below.

session token of fahif-tadup = htk3_9c7

**Ticket QTA-219: Quota vault locked after failed rotation**

The Bramblegate quota vault (stores per-tenant rate limits) sealed itself after last night's key rotation job crashed midway. Tenants are falling back to default quotas, so no outage, but overrides are frozen. To unseal, run the recovery tool on the primary node; for future maintainers, the required recovery passphrase is kept immediately below this note.

strongbox words: norwyn-wenael-aldvan-aldiel-wendor-holael

ENG SYNC NOTE — Tallyforge billing worker. Last week's blue-green cutover stalled because the green environment was cloned from a stale template: the worker booted against the blue queue and double-processed two invoice batches. We've since split the env files per color and added a preflight check that refuses to start if the deploy color doesn't match the queue prefix. The green .env is now correct except for one credential. The broker auth token for the green worker goes on the line directly below.

vault entry, kahop-kagug: RELAY_SECRET3=6ea

**Vendor note: Inkmill markdown pipeline**

Rendering for Parchway docs is outsourced to Inkmill under an annual contract, renewing each March. They handle sanitization and PDF export; we own the upload queue. SLA: 4-hour response on rendering failures. Escalate only after two failed retries. Their support desk is reachable at the address below.

billing contact of hahaf-baguf = zorael.tammir.jorius@sivrelhq.internal

**Ticket: Baseline sync connection failures**

The Lintvault static-analysis baseline file fails to sync when the uploader can't reach the findings store; retries exhaust after five attempts. Root cause last time: stale pooler config after the Ostermark DC move. Future maintainers: check pool settings first, then credentials. The uploader reads its target from config and connects with the connection string below.

replica DSN, kajep-yahag: mssql://praok_svc:iF@db-8d68.plorvaio.local:5432/eliion